I am satisfied with the college.
Placements: In our mechanical engineering batch, 70% of students got placed. The packages are between 3 LPA and 8 LPA to 9 LPA, with an average of about 4 LPA to 5 LPA. Companies like Tata Motors, Mahindra, Cummins, and L&T come for placements. Almost half of the students also got internships in firms such as Tata, Bosch, and Bharat Forge. Most of us are offered roles like GET, design engineer, production, or quality engineer.
Infrastructure: Our department has Wi-Fi, spacious classrooms, updated labs, and a good library. Hostel rooms are decent with Wi-Fi. Mess food is average but hygienic, and the canteen has variety. Medical care is available. Sports and cultural activities make campus life active.
Faculty: All teachers are highly supportive, encouraging, and student-friendly with good knowledge. As the college is autonomous, the exam pattern is slightly different from the university. The curriculum is updated and relevant, making students industry-ready.

Overall, the college is well and good. Last year, the maximum package was about 24 LPA.
Placements: Placements are good in this college. As a mechanical student, I think it's a better college for placements. In my course, about 80% of students were placed last year. The highest package in CS was 24 LPA, and the average is 9-11 LPA, which is pretty good. Many companies visit the campus, e.g., Amdocs, Persistent, TCS, etc.
Infrastructure: The course and the syllabus of the first year are good, as the institute is autonomous. This year, there is a slight change in the pattern and syllabus. The Wi-Fi facility is not that good. The classrooms' infrastructure is well-maintained. The library facility is also very good, and the maintenance of books is good. The canteen and mess infrastructure are very good. But the only thing is, if you are a day scholar, you may find some problems with eating tiffin. The sports facilities can be better.
Faculty: The teachers are very supportive and helpful in everything. As the institute is autonomous now, you will not face much difficulty in passing. The teaching quality is good, and you may find some problems in some subjects initially, but later it will be easier. Attendance is strictly 75% compulsory.
Other: Events are well-organized. I am in my 1st year, so I don't have much more information about it, but our fresher's party was awesome. There are many more extracurricular activities. The campus is not too big, but it's still pretty good, with greenery all around.

Our college is popular because of high packages placement.
Placements: Our department has about 65% to 70% placement. And the highest package is 13 LPA to 14 LPA. An average package is 3.50 LPA to 4 LPA. The top companies of our department are Tata, Mahindra Logistics, Finolex Cables, Force Motors, Hettich, and Blue Star.
Infrastructure: Our classes have projectors as well as digital and normal boards. There is also a departmental library. And there is also Wi-Fi service. The hostel also has Wi-Fi, and the mess is also good. Hostels can accommodate 3 or 2 children per room. The room has all the essentials.
Faculty: The teachers of our department are highly educated and have a lot of experience. They teach very well. And also help students. And all together prepare the students to enter the industry. The semester exam is a bit difficult, but if you understand it well, it is easy.

Review of Indira College Of Engineering & MGT.
Placements: For us, mechanical placement is the worst in our class, with only 25 students placed out of 75. TCS, L&T, and Datamatics companies visit here. We get internships from colleges in local companies with 7–10k stipends; some get unpaid internships. The top roles offered are trainee engineer and GET.
Infrastructure: The college has the facilities of an open gym, an auditorium, a seminar hall, and a common room. Free internet is available at the computer lab. The hostel is average. Ragging happened in our time, and I think now it's gone. Mess food is average quality; there are 3 canteens on campus. Sports ground preparation has started in our batch now; football, cricket and basketball courts have become like new.
Faculty: Teachers are Ph.D. qualified, and all have more than 6 years of experience. With teaching experience, they try to provide practical knowledge through teaching. The course makes the students industry-ready, and those who have an interest in IT college should attend separate sessions. Semester exams are difficult because SPPU conducts them.
Other: I chose this course because I have a lower MHT-CET score so I got mechanical instead of IT. The placement of core branch need to improve. An event or fest is organized every year in January.
